Job Description

The firm offers a collaborative, team-oriented environment where attorneys gain significant experience while working alongside experienced mentors. This role provides autonomy, opportunities for professional development, and meaningful client interaction.

Job Responsibility

  • Analyze complex legal and factual issues, conduct comprehensive legal research, and develop effective defense strategies
  • Prepare pleadings, discovery documents, motions, briefs, and other legal filings
  • Conduct depositions, including expert and fact witness examinations
  • Provide clear and timely legal counsel to clients and claims professionals
  • Represent clients in trials, hearings, arbitrations, and other dispute resolution proceedings
  • Communicate effectively with courts, witnesses, opposing counsel, and internal teams

Requirements

  •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ree and active Delaware bar admission (admissions in other states will be considered)
  • Minimum of 1 year of experience in Bankruptcy or experience in Delaware courts
  • Litigation experience, including depositions, discovery, motions practice, and oral argument
  • Strong legal research and writing abilities
  • Exceptional attention to detail and organizational skills
  • Demonstrated commitment to professional growth and client service
